In this episode of the Transitions Daily Alcoholics Anonymous Recovery Readings Podcast, you'll hear a collection of powerful recovery quotes and reflections. Kurt L from Albuquerque, New Mexico, reads a series of thoughtful passages from various AA resources, including 'Twenty-Four Hours a Day', 'Daily Reflections', and 'As Bill Sees It'. The theme for March 30th is 'The Past', exploring how embracing one's past can be a cornerstone for helping others and finding personal happiness.
The readings highlight the importance of solitude in recovery, offering a space for introspection and spiritual growth. You'll also find reflections on group conscience and the idea that true leadership in AA is about being a trusted servant rather than a ruler. The episode encourages you to review your day constructively, focusing on what you can do for others and how to improve yourself without falling into worry or remorse.
Kurt shares personal anecdotes and AA wisdom, reminding you that even in moments of loneliness, there is strength to be found. The readings suggest that by cherishing moments of solitude, you can better understand your wrongs and seek guidance from a higher power. There's also a poignant reminder that your past, no matter how dark, can be the greatest asset in helping others avoid misery and find their own path to recovery.
